Sooke Campground Flats Green Space
Sooke Campground Flats Green Space is in the seaside community of Sooke, one of thirteen communities that form the Capital Regional District of British Columbia. A privately owed business, this four hectare campground lies on the confluence of DeMamiel Creek and Sooke River. Sooke Potholes Parks
Sooke Potholes Provincial and Regional Parks are in the seaside community of Sooke, one of thirteen communities that form the Capital Regional District of British Columbia. Located on the southern end of Vancouver Island, the two parks are side-by-side and provide protection and access to the popular summer swimming destination.
